    Labor & Birth Terms to Know: Abruptio Placenta (Placental Abruption): The placenta has started to separate from the uterine wall before the baby is born. Amniotic Fluid: This protective liquid, consisting mostly of fetal urine and water, fills the sac surrounding the fetus. APGAR : A measurement of the newborn’s response to birth and life outside the womb.

    Cervix – The lowest portion of the uterus that thins out and opens during labor for the delivery of the baby. Dilation – The opening of the cervix for delivery of the baby. Measured in centimeters from 0 to 10. Doula – A professional labor support person or postpartum helper. Effacement – The thinning and shortening of the cervix ...
